Acoustic America: Iconic Guitars, Mandolins, and Banjos
This handsome catalog accompanied MIM’s special exhibition, Acoustic America: Iconic Guitars, Mandolins, and Banjos and features full-color photography of historic stringed acoustic instruments—mandolins, guitars, banjos, ukuleles, and more—that have shaped generations of American music since before the Civil War and have been played by the heroes of folk, blues, and bluegrass music. The text was written by Richard Walter, PhD, MIM’s senior curator for United States / Canada.
MIM’s exhibition presented 90 instruments that illustrated the overlapping histories of exceptional soloists and songwriters, groundbreaking manufacturers, and novel inventions and demonstrated how diverse origins combined into enduring traditions. Some examples came from private collectors, including 30 special instruments from the personal collection of David Grisman, which are on public display for the first time.
